This concept is awesome, but needs some PR reworking. Can we consider renaming this to something like "restricted," "confidential," "personal," "private" or "nonpublic" . "Stealth" has an off-the-books connotation that doesn't fit what govs. want to see in Crypto right now.

Maybe since it is in essence a Diffie-Hellman key exchange technique ... you could call it Forward Privacy Transaction or DH-TX or some such ... i.e. in same name as the original cryptographic technique it is based upon?
